WarcraftHelper:5个模块化方案,让魔兽争霸3在现代电脑上焕发新生
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
还在为经典游戏魔兽争霸3在现代电脑上运行卡顿、显示异常而苦恼吗?WarcraftHelper这款开源魔兽争霸3优化工具,专为解决1.20e到1.27b全版本兼容性问题而生。通过五个精心设计的模块化功能组合,它能一键解决分辨率适配、帧率锁定、地图限制等核心痛点,让你的游戏体验从“勉强运行”升级到“流畅如新”。
🎯 场景一:宽屏显示器玩家的困扰与解决方案
问题场景:你使用16:9的现代显示器,但魔兽争霸3原生只支持4:3比例,导致游戏画面两侧出现恼人的黑边,或者UI界面被拉伸变形。
WarcraftHelper的解决方案:宽屏适配模块
这个模块智能检测你的显示器比例,自动调整游戏渲染逻辑。它不只是简单拉伸画面,而是保持原始游戏比例的同时,让画面充满整个屏幕。UI界面、文字、按钮都保持正常显示,不会出现变形或错位。
配置方法:在WarcraftHelper.ini文件中设置:
WideScreen = true AutoFullScreen = false # 推荐保持窗口化以获得最佳兼容性🚀 场景二:高刷新率显示器的性能释放
问题场景:你的显示器支持144Hz甚至更高刷新率,但魔兽争霸3原版锁定在60FPS,导致画面卡顿、操作延迟,无法发挥硬件性能。
WarcraftHelper的解决方案:帧率优化模块
解锁原版60FPS限制,支持自定义目标帧率设置。无论是60Hz、144Hz还是240Hz显示器,都能获得匹配刷新率的流畅画面。模块还包含FPS显示功能,让你实时监控游戏性能。
进阶配置:
UnlockFPS = true ShowFPS = true FpsLimit = true TargetFps = 144 # 根据你的显示器刷新率设置WarcraftHelper的文件管理模块界面,帮助解决中文路径兼容性问题
📁 场景三:大型自定义地图玩家的福音
问题场景:你下载了超过8MB的大型RPG地图,但游戏提示“地图太大无法加载”,让你与精彩内容失之交臂。
WarcraftHelper的解决方案:地图限制解除模块
彻底突破原版8MB地图大小限制,支持加载各种大型自定义地图。无论是复杂的防守图、剧情丰富的RPG,还是创新的对战地图,都能顺利加载运行。
关键配置:
UnlockMapSize = true🔧 场景四:中文用户的路径兼容性困扰
问题场景:你的游戏安装在中文目录下,或者地图文件包含中文名称,导致游戏无法正常读取文件,出现各种奇怪的错误。
WarcraftHelper的解决方案:路径修复模块
这个模块专门处理中文路径和文件名兼容性问题,确保游戏能够正确识别和加载所有文件。无论是游戏安装目录、地图文件还是录像文件,中文路径都不再是问题。
📹 场景五:录像管理与回放需求
问题场景:精彩的比赛结束后,你想保存录像分析战术,但原版游戏的录像管理功能简陋,文件容易丢失或混乱。
WarcraftHelper的解决方案:自动录像管理模块
自动保存每一场对战的录像文件,并按日期时间智能分类。所有录像都保存在专门的WHReplay/子目录中,查找和管理变得异常简单。
录像功能配置:
AutoSaveReplay = true🛠️ 渐进式优化路径:从安装到精通
第一步:基础部署(3分钟完成)
- 获取工具:通过git克隆或下载压缩包
git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per - 放置位置:将解压后的文件放在魔兽争霸3游戏根目录
- 首次运行:必须使用窗口化模式启动游戏,完成必要的注册表初始化
第二步:个性化配置(2分钟调整)
打开WarcraftHelper.ini文件,根据你的需求调整设置。文件结构清晰,每个选项都有详细的中文注释:
# 基础性能优化 UnlockFPS = true ShowFPS = true TargetFps = 144 # 显示适配 WideScreen = true AutoFullScreen = false # 功能扩展 UnlockMapSize = true AutoSaveReplay = true第三步:功能验证(1分钟测试)
逐一测试各项功能是否正常工作:
- 按F7键刷新窗口,检查高分辨率下的字体重叠问题
- 进入游戏查看FPS显示是否开启
- 尝试加载大型地图验证限制解除
- 进行一场比赛后检查录像是否自动保存
🧩 模块化功能组合:打造专属优化方案
WarcraftHelper采用模块化设计,源码结构清晰易懂:
WarcraftHelper/ ├── WarcraftHelper.ini # 主配置文件 ├── WHLoader/ # 加载器模块 ├── WarcraftHelper/ # 核心功能源码 │ ├── plugin/ # 插件系统目录 │ │ ├── widescreen.cpp # 宽屏支持模块 │ │ ├── unlockfps.cpp # 帧率优化模块 │ │ ├── sizebypass.cpp # 地图限制解除模块 │ │ ├── pathfix.cpp # 路径修复模块 │ │ └── autorep.cpp # 自动录像模块 │ └── config/ # 配置管理模块 └── d3d9/ # DirectX兼容层竞技玩家组合方案
UnlockFPS = true ShowFPS = true ShowHPBar = true # 1.20e版本特别支持 TargetFps = 144RPG爱好者组合方案
WideScreen = true UnlockMapSize = true AutoSaveReplay = true PathFix = true怀旧玩家组合方案
WideScreen = true UnlockFPS = true TargetFps = 60 # 保持经典感觉 AutoFullScreen = false💡 实用技巧与最佳实践
分辨率设置黄金法则
- 1080p显示器:1920×1080分辨率,平衡清晰度与性能
- 2K显示器:2560×1440分辨率,享受更细腻的画面
- 4K显示器:3840×2160分辨率,注意使用F7键解决字体重叠
版本兼容性智能选择
- 1.20e老版本:建议配合d3d8to9补丁使用,减少DirectX兼容性问题
- 1.24e及更新版本:原生兼容性更好,可直接使用所有功能
- 混合版本环境:为不同版本创建独立的配置文件,方便切换
配置文件管理策略
- 备份原始配置:修改前复制一份WarcraftHelper.ini.bak
- 渐进式调整:一次只修改1-2个设置,测试效果后再继续
- 注释学习:配置文件中的中文注释是了解每个功能的最佳指南
🎮 立即行动:3个步骤开启优化之旅
第一步:环境准备确保你的魔兽争霸3版本在1.20e到1.27b之间,这是WarcraftHelper的完整支持范围。
第二步:工具部署将WarcraftHelper文件放置在游戏根目录,保持原有文件结构不变。
第三步:启动验证用窗口化模式启动游戏,检查控制台输出或游戏内功能是否正常加载。
无论你是追求极致性能的竞技玩家、热爱大型RPG的地图爱好者,还是重温经典的怀旧玩家,WarcraftHelper都能提供量身定制的优化方案。五个模块化功能可以自由组合,解决你在现代电脑上运行魔兽争霸3时遇到的各种兼容性问题。
现在就开始你的优化之旅,让这款经典游戏在现代硬件上焕发全新的生命力!
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考